UK Youth Parliament is a national organisation, and countrywide over 500 young people get elected each year. In Ealing we have 2 places to fill. The young people elected will:
represent young people's voices from the Borough of Ealing on a national level
try to make links with top Politicians, Local MP's and Councillors to promote young people's views
meet with the London Region of UK Youth Parliament on a monthly basis, in Westminster City Hall
be invited to attend the UK Youth Parliament Annual Sitting; take part in a 4 day programme of debating, campaigning and skill development.
be invited to sit for one day in the House of Commons with the rest of UKYP, and take part in debates which are televised and considered by Government itself.
UKYP members are the only group aside from elected MP's who are offered this privilege.
